
The annual Halloween episode, “Treehouse of Horror,” will also deliver this season. “We have what I think is the scariest segment we ever did,” said executive producer Al Jean. “I don’t want to say more.” It’ll also have a 3D parody of Neil Gaiman’s Coraline called “Coralisa,” which features Gaiman as the voice of the cat. In another segment, Maggie will become possessed and The Exorcist star Ben Daniels will voice the role of the priest. “Maggie says, ‘You’re all going to die,’ and Marge is excited,” said Jean, “because it’s Maggie first words.”
There will also be plenty of big name guest stars throughout the season. Daniel Radcliffe, who has already played the son of Dracula and a boy who enjoys falconry, will cameo as himself in an episode about Bart using Sun Tzu’s The Art of War to destroy Homer. “They go to a Minecraft-like convention and Daniel is there wearing a costume,” said Jean. “That’s how people like him go to conventions without being seen, and Homer unmasks him, and he gets torn to shreds.”
The Simpsons will return to FOX on Oct. 1. Treehouse of Horror XXVIII episode airing Sunday, Oct. 22, (8:00-8:30 PM ET/PT) on FOX.
